Treasury Bills
Short-term government securities issued at a discount from the face value and maturing at par, offering a return to investors.
Dividend
A portion of a company's earnings distributed to its shareholders, usually in the form of cash or additional stock.
Expected Rate Of Return
The anticipated gain or loss on an investment over a specific period, usually expressed as a percentage.
Portfolio
An assortment of monetary assets such as shares, bonds, goods, money, and money equivalents, along with closed-end funds and exchange-traded funds (ETFs).
